Damaged roof replacement in Lincoln, RI, involves assessing the extent of damage and selecting appropriate materials to restore roof integrity. The scope of work can vary based on the size of the roof, the complexity of the existing structure,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for roof replacement projects.

  • Materials used may include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, depending on the existing roof and homeowner preferences.
  • The size and scope of the roof influence the overall project duration and complexity, with larger or multi-story roofs requiring more extensive work.
  • Labor complexity varies based on roof pitch, accessibility, and the presence of features like chimneys or skylights.
  • Permitting requirements in Lincoln, RI, may necessitate inspections or approvals before work begins, especially for significant replacements.
  • Additional services such as roof decking repair, flashing replacement, or gutter installation may be included as extras in the project scope.
